I am presenting one of my chip. I left it in my collection as it has funny picture on it. It is Santa Claus I think. Do you have or have seen any other pictures on ICs? I know that there pictures on dies but on the IC it seems to be very rare. The one I am presenting comes from old IBM ThinkPad laptop.

Very interesting. It's not Santa Claus, but the God of Luck believed in Japanese folklore. He is an almighty person and when he swings the hammer, he can take out anything you want.
